Linear Actuators are key motion control components, converting rotary motion into linear motion and making them the perfect partners for all sorts of projects.

This 6V Linear Actuator may look small, but don't let its size deceive you. It packs a punch with a thrust of 128N and a stroke of 50mm. Just add 6V of electricity and watch it move with precision and control. The direction of its movement is controlled through simple wiring that you can connect to a 6V power supply. Its short stroke of 50mm is perfect for access control systems, DIY lifting projects, electric telescopic poles, and anything else that requires a bit of linear muscle. This 6V Linear Actuator also features two mounting holes on each end for secure attachment to two objects you want to move apart or together. 6V Linear Actuator 50mm - Technical Specifications:

  • Manufacturer

– DFRobot

  • Operating Voltage

– 5V

  • Stroke

– 50mm

  • Thrust

– 128N

  • Weight

– 65g

  • End Piece

– 9.29 x 6.1mm | Ø4 Mounting Hole

  • Dimensions (Retracted)

– 63.5 x 54.5mm

  • Dimensions (Extended)

– 113.5 x 104.5mm

As self-proclaimed “Robo-holics”, DFRobot is a company comprised of over 100 staff members, of which 30% are engineers who love to build robots. It was started in 2008 with the goal of embracing and promoting open-source hardware, with a core focus on Arduino, Raspberry Pi and their very own LattePanda development boards. Since then, DFRobot have manufactured over 1300 unique modules, sensors and components that all work together and complement each other, allowing users like us to enjoy a full spectrum of cutting edge robotics and electronics without having to pay premium prices.


With the primary goal of developing and manufacturing great quality products, while making them accessible to as many people as possible, DFRobot are rapidly becoming one of the most common-place brands in the world of open-source robotics and electronics.
